如何在服务器上快速搭建网站?

服务器上快速建站是一个涉及多个步骤的过程,包括选择服务器、安装操作系统、配置网络环境、安装Web服务器软件、部署网站内容等,以下是一份详细的指南:

选择合适的服务器

你需要选择一个适合你需求的服务器,这可能意味着购买一台物理服务器,或者租用一台虚拟服务器(如VPS或云服务器),考虑以下因素:

性能需求:CPU核心数、内存大小、存储空间和带宽。

可靠性:服务器的正常运行时间和备份选项。

成本:预算内的最佳性价比。

扩展性:未来升级和扩展的能力。

地理位置:服务器位置对网站加载速度的影响。

安装操作系统

大多数服务器都预装了操作系统,但如果没有,你需要自行安装,对于Web服务器,常见的选择是Linux发行版,如Ubuntu Server、CentOS或Debian,Windows Server也是一个选项,尤其是如果你打算使用ASP.NET或其他Microsoft技术。

配置网络环境

一旦操作系统安装完成,你需要配置网络设置,确保服务器可以访问互联网,并且可以被外部访问,这通常涉及设置静态IP地址、配置DNS记录和开放必要的端口。

安装Web服务器软件

你需要安装Web服务器软件来托管你的网站,Apache和Nginx是两个流行的开源选项,它们都有丰富的文档和社区支持。

Apache:广泛使用,配置相对简单,支持多种模块和插件。

Nginx:轻量级,高性能,擅长处理大量并发连接。

将你的网站文件上传到服务器,这可以通过FTP、SCP或通过Web服务器提供的控制面板来完成,确保文件权限正确设置,以便Web服务器可以读取它们。

配置域名和SSL证书

为了使用户能够通过域名访问你的网站,你需要将域名指向你的服务器的IP地址,这通常涉及更新DNS记录,为了提高安全性和信任度,建议安装SSL证书来启用HTTPS。

优化和维护

定期更新服务器软件,监控性能,并采取措施保护网站免受攻击,这可能包括安装防火墙、使用安全插件和定期备份数据。

相关问答FAQs

Q1: 我应该如何选择服务器的位置?

A1: 服务器的位置应该基于你的目标受众,如果你的用户主要位于亚洲,那么选择一个亚洲的数据中心会更好,因为这将减少延迟并提高加载速度,如果用户遍布全球,你可能需要考虑使用CDN(内容分发网络)来优化全球访问速度。

Q2: 我是否需要专业的IT知识来在服务器上建站?

A2: 虽然基本的IT知识和对命令行界面的熟悉会有所帮助,但现在有许多用户友好的工具和服务使得没有深厚技术背景的人也能在服务器上建站,许多Web主机提供一键安装脚本和图形化控制面板,简化了建站过程,对于更复杂的配置和高级功能,一些专业知识可能是必要的。

各位小伙伴们,我刚刚为大家分享了有关“服务器里快速建站”的知识,希望对你们有所帮助。如果您还有其他相关问题需要解决,欢迎随时提出哦!

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2024-12-12 02:48
下一篇 2024-12-12 03:00

相关推荐

  • api接口怎么在jsp中调用

    在JSP中调用API接口,通常可以通过以下几种方式:,,1. **使用Java代码直接调用**:在JSP页面中,通过`标签嵌入Java代码,使用HttpURLConnection`或第三方库(如Apache HttpClient)来发送HTTP请求并处理响应。,,2. **通过Servlet调用**:在Servlet中编写调用API的逻辑,然后将结果转发到JSP页面进行显示。这样可以实现业务逻辑与视图的分离。,,3. **利用AJAX技术**:在JSP页面中使用JavaScript发起AJAX请求,调用后端的Servlet或Controller,再由它们去调用API接口。这种方式可以提供更好的用户体验,因为页面不需要整体刷新。,,4. **使用JSTL和EL表达式**:如果API返回的数据格式较为简单且固定,可以考虑使用JSTL(JSP Standard Tag Library)和EL(Expression Language)来简化数据的获取和展示过程。,,具体选择哪种方式取决于项目的具体需求、团队的技术栈以及个人偏好。

    2025-04-06
    007
  • dingtalk api_查询审批实例

    dingtalk api查询审批实例是使用钉钉开放平台提供的api接口,通过编写代码实现对钉钉审批流程的查询和管理。

    2024-07-12
    009
  • 负载均衡与冗余备份,如何确保系统高效稳定运行?

    负载均衡与冗余备份是提高系统可靠性和性能的关键技术,本文将详细探讨负载均衡和冗余备份的概念、实现方式以及相关技术,并通过表格形式展示不同方案的特点和适用场景,一、负载均衡概述1. 概念与重要性负载均衡是一种在多台服务器或网络设备之间分配工作负载的技术,旨在优化资源使用、最大化吞吐量、最小化响应时间,并避免任何单……

    2024-12-11
    0089
  • arm linux 音频

    在ARM Linux系统上处理音频,可使用ALSA或PulseAudio框架。需配置内核支持,安装相关驱动与库,利用工具如arecord和aplay进行录制与播放。

    2025-04-25
    005

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

广告合作

QQ:14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信